  1. Local Heroes 5th June 1938
    Many years ago there lived in Mullahoran a man named Patrick McDermot who was the strongest man in the parish. He was always boasting of his strength so the people called him "The Heroe."
    He could carry three times his own weight up fourteen steps of a ladder. He could throw a weight of four stone across a rope ten feet in height.
